<p>The class template <a class="link" href="unordered_set.html" title="Class template unordered_set">unordered_set</a> is an intrusive container, that mimics most of the interface of std::tr1::unordered_set as described in the C++ TR1.</p>
<p><a class="link" href="unordered_set.html" title="Class template unordered_set">unordered_set</a> is a semi-intrusive container: each object to be stored in the container must contain a proper hook, but the container also needs additional auxiliary memory to work: <a class="link" href="unordered_set.html" title="Class template unordered_set">unordered_set</a> needs a pointer to an array of type <code class="computeroutput">bucket_type</code> to be passed in the constructor. This bucket array must have at least the same lifetime as the container. This makes the use of <a class="link" href="unordered_set.html" title="Class template unordered_set">unordered_set</a> more complicated than purely intrusive containers. <code class="computeroutput">bucket_type</code> is default-constructible, copyable and assignable</p>
<p>The template parameter <code class="computeroutput">T</code> is the type to be managed by the container. The user can specify additional options and if no options are provided default options are used.</p>

<p><a class="link" href="unordered_set.html" title="Class template unordered_set">unordered_set</a>, unlike std::unordered_set, does not make automatic rehashings nor offers functions related to a load factor. Rehashing can be explicitly requested and the user must provide a new bucket array that will be used from that moment.</p>
<p>Since no automatic rehashing is done, iterators are never invalidated when inserting or erasing elements. Iterators are only invalidated when rehasing. </p>
